isRequireEndOfData
public boolean isRequireEndOfData() -
setRequireEndOfData
public void setRequireEndOfData(boolean requireEndOfData) Enable/Disable strict compliance to the MLLP standard. The MLLP standard specifies [START_OF_BLOCK]hl7 payload[END_OF_BLOCK][END_OF_DATA], however, some systems do not send the final END_OF_DATA byte. This setting controls whether or not the final END_OF_DATA byte is required or optional.- Parameters:
requireEndOfData
- the trailing END_OF_DATA byte is required if true; optional otherwise

isStringPayload
public boolean isStringPayload() -
setStringPayload
public void setStringPayload(boolean stringPayload) Enable/Disable converting the payload to a String. If enabled, HL7 Payloads received from external systems will be validated converted to a String. If the charsetName property is set, that character set will be used for the conversion. If the charsetName property is not set, the value of MSH-18 will be used to determine th appropriate character set. If MSH-18 is not set, then the default ISO-8859-1 character set will be use.- Parameters:
stringPayload
- enabled if true, otherwise disabled

isValidatePayload
public boolean isValidatePayload() -
setValidatePayload
public void setValidatePayload(boolean validatePayload) Enable/Disable the validation of HL7 Payloads If enabled, HL7 Payloads received from external systems will be validated (see Hl7Util.generateInvalidPayloadExceptionMessage for details on the validation). If and invalid payload is detected, a MllpInvalidMessageException (for consumers) or a MllpInvalidAcknowledgementException will be thrown.- Parameters:
validatePayload
- enabled if true, otherwise disabled

getIdleTimeoutStrategy
-
setIdleTimeoutStrategy
decide what action to take when idle timeout occurs. Possible values are : RESET: set SO_LINGER to 0 and reset the socket CLOSE: close the socket gracefully default is RESET.- Parameters:
idleTimeoutStrategy
- the strategy to take if idle timeout occurs
